Compartilhar via


estrutura D3DWDDM2_0DDIARG_TEX2D_SHADERRESOURCEVIEW (d3d10umddi.h)

A estrutura D3DWDDM2_0DDIARG_TEX2D_SHADERRESOURCEVIEW descreve uma textura bidimensional (2D) usada para criar uma exibição de recurso de sombreador em uma chamada para CreateShaderResourceView.

Sintaxe

typedef struct D3DWDDM2_0DDIARG_TEX2D_SHADERRESOURCEVIEW {
  UINT MostDetailedMip;
  UINT FirstArraySlice;
  UINT MipLevels;
  UINT ArraySize;
  UINT PlaneSlice;
  UINT PlaneIndex;
} D3DWDDM2_0DDIARG_TEX2D_SHADERRESOURCEVIEW;

Membros

MostDetailedMip

[in] O identificador do mapa de MIP mais detalhado.

FirstArraySlice

[in] O identificador da primeira fatia de matriz.

MipLevels

[in] O número de níveis de mapa MIP para a textura.

ArraySize

[in] O número de fatias de matriz para a textura.

PlaneSlice

[in] O identificador da fatia do plano.

PlaneIndex

[in] O índice (número de fatia do plano) do plano a ser usado na textura.

Comentários

Se MipLevels estiver definido como -1, o MIP mapeia na textura a partir do MIP-map que é definido no membro MostDetailedMip .

Se ArraySize estiver definido como -1, as fatias de matriz na textura começarão a partir da fatia de matriz definida no membro FirstArraySlice .

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ows 10 (WDDM 2.0)
Cabeçalho d3d10umddi.h

Confira também

CalcPrivateShaderResourceViewSize

CreateShaderResourceView

D3DWDDM2_0DDIARG_CREATESHADERRESOURCEVIEW